> > I am trying to install gawk on snowleopard with fink.
> > I am completely new at mac and fink, so might be something very stupid..
> > sorry in advance
> >
> > I installed fink, everything seemed to work find. I kept all mirrors and
> > repo to default.
> > when I try to install gawk, i get :
> >
> > sudo apt-get install gawk
> > Password:
> > Reading Package Lists... Done
> > Building Dependency Tree... Done
> > E: Couldn't find package gawk
> >
> > sudo apt-get update
> > fink update-all
> > fink scanpackages
> > fink selfupdate-rsync
> > as advise by forums I read, everything seemed to work fine but it didn't
> > solve my problem..
> >
> > when I check fink list, gawk is in the list.
> >
> > I must be missing something, but what? :)
> >
> > (I dont really want to make fink works, i just need gawk. so if you know
> a
> > simple to get it, it help also)
> >
> > Thanks!
>
> You're missing the fact that there isn't a binary distribution for 10.6,
> and so what you need to use is
>
> fink install gawk
